– Characteristics and flavor profile
Pepmint tea comes in a variety of flavors and types, each offering a unique twist on the classic refreshing taste. The characteristics and flavor profiles differ based on factors like the origin of the mint, processing methods, and additional ingredients used during production. For instance, some varieties feature spearmint, known for its crisp, cool note with subtle sweetness, while others incorporate peppermint that offers a more intense menthol punch. Some unique blends even mix different types of mint or combine them with herbs like chamomile or ginger to create complex flavor profiles that cater to diverse tastes.
